The Cadillac V series of high-performance vehicles rolled out in 2003 with the 2004 model year CTS-V. The second-generation Cadillac CTS-V was offered in five-, four-, and two-door forms, with all three of them relying on a supercharged V8 mill.
E60/E61 (2003-2010) Initially rolling off the production line in 2003, the fifth-generation 5-Series brought a significant exterior overhaul with its departure from the boxy body lines of its predecessors. The new iteration also boasted a turbocharged straight-six option, the first turbo fitted to a 5-Series model.

Operational since 2003, the US-based plant started engine assembly in April of that year with V8s. Toyota has recently produced its 10 millionth engine at TMMAL in Alabama. V6 lumps followed suit in 2005, then 2011 saw the introduction of I4s for the 2012 Camry, Venza, Highlander, Sienna, and RAV4.
